When you are a programmer, does spelling matter?

in #english7 years ago

Good evening, dear community. In this opportunity, the post that I bring to you is about the relationship between spelling and grammar with computer programming.

Certainly for some programmers, and computer workers the spelling does not matter, since they think that the fact that the program does the work that is asked for is sufficient. Well, I let you know that according to sources that I will leave at the end of the post, they say that spelling is important at the time of programming, so much so that there are companies in some countries that do not tolerate that a programmer does not write correctly, and therefore they will never have a job in those companies.

Particularly to me, it seems to me that regardless of the area of ​​work, spelling should be taken care of, since everything we write and read is interpreted in one way or another according to how it is written and the punctuation marks in the text, since many words are pronounced in the same way, and what gives us the understanding of this is the context in which it is used.

In many cases, there are those who argue that to earn a large amount of money, they do not need to write well, and it may be true, but this argument has no validity since this is not applicable in all cases, and what will really be a excuse not to accept that they have bad spelling.

When we make a computer program, we must respect the syntax of the language we are using, because if not, this will give us error reports after error and can not be compiled correctly, so, being this the case, we can ask ourselves What does not also respect the spelling of the language in which we develop the program? remember that when we develop any application, the screen will show words, messages with reports or information to the user, which must be correctly written, since many would not like to see something like this:

Remember also, that computer programs, print reports that in many cases are used as legal or fiscal documentation (in the case of invoices to cite an example), in addition every program must have a user manual, which must be written correctly so that it is understandable to who or who have to use it.

How do I improve the spelling?

In this case I particularly recommend reading books, magazines and any information that is of interest so that it does not seem boring, but from reliable, official sources among others, remember that if we enter, for example, a public forum, anyone enters, writes and leave your comment, but there is no guarantee that your spelling is the best. Also document with the use of punctuation marks, the rules of some letters, among others so that little by little we improve and they will see that they will be better programmers of applications, since this helps to develop our language, enrich it and make us more skillful when interpreting the texts we read.
